Chapter 13: Excellence Of Euphrates, Drinking Its Water And Performing Ghusl In It

Tradition 1: Amir Al-Mu’minin ('a) said: Water is the chief of the drinks of this world and Hereafter. Four rivers in this world are from Paradise: Euphrates, Nile, Saihan and Jaihan. Euphrates contains water, Nile contains honey, Saihan contains wine, and Jaihan, milk.

Tradition 2: Imam As-Sadiq (‘a) said: If Euphrates water is used to open the mouth of a newborn and is his first drink, he will be among those who love us, Ahl Al-Bayt.

Tradition 3: Imam Al-Baqir ('a) said: If the distance between us and Euphrates was so and so, we would go to it to seek cure from its water.

Tradition 4: Similar to no. 2 and 3.

Tradition 5: Imam As-Sadiq (‘a) explained the verse,

آيَةً وَآوَيْنَاهُمَا إِلَىٰ رَبْوَةٍ ذَاتِ قَرَارٍ وَمَعِينٍ

“And We gave them a shelter on a lofty ground having meadows and springs” (23:50).

He said, 'meadows' refers to Najaf of Kufa and 'spring' refers to Euphrates.”

Tradition 6: Ali ('a) said: Euphrates is the chief of the water bodies in the world and Hereafter.

Tradition 7: Imam As-Sajjad ('a) said: Every night an angel descends and drops three pieces of musk from the musk of Paradise in Euphrates. There is no river more blessed than Euphrates anywhere in the east or west.

Tradition 8: Imam As-Sadiq (‘a) said: Everyday some drops fall from Paradise into Euphrates.

Tradition 9: When Imam As-Sadiq (‘a) came to Kufa during the time of Abil Abbas, he was on his mount in his traveling gear. He stopped on Kufa bridge and asked his servant to give him some water. The servant took a jug from Euphrates and gave it to Imam ('a) who began to drink it, and as he drank the water spilled from corners of his mouth on his beard and clothes. Then Imam ('a) asked for some more. The servant refilled the jug and gave it to him. After he drank the water, he praised Allah and said: What a blessed river it is! Indeed, everyday seven drops of water fall from Paradise into it. If people knew of the blessings of this river, they would build their tents on its banks. Indeed, if it was not for that which enters this river from the sinners, no ill person would immerse himself in it without being cured.

Tradition 16: Imam As-Sadiq (‘a) said: There are two believing rivers and two disbelieving rivers. The two disbelieving rivers are Balkh and Tigris, and the two believing rivers are Nile and Euphrates. So, open the mouth of your children with Euphrates water.
